I think to "live worship before going live with worship" is when you have your heart already prepared for what you're about to step into.
When we're on stage, it can't be about us. Being up there is about leading others into God's presence...they look to us for the next move...I mean, if we were up there singing or playing an instrument and just going through the motions...or if we are up there just pretending when we know deep down in our hearts that we are not pure or ready to lead others into worship...then what are we doing? We can't show people something we haven't stepped into yet, so when we're up there it has to be REAL. I don't believe in faking worship because it's like putting on a mask.

To live worship before going live is to also be the SAME person at church as you are where ever you go. That's so important that we are worshiping and praying at home as well as church...talking to people about Jesus and what he's done in our lives...loving others as much as we love ourselves and putting them first.

Another point is to be careful not to fall into the ways of this world that are tempting us...God looks for hearts that are after Him and not how "amazing" they sound when they're singing or playing...He wants us to be so full of Him that we can't help but love and encourage others...

Romans 12:2, "Do not conform to the patterns of this world, but be transformed by the renewing of your mind. Then you will be able to test and approve what God's will is-His good and perfect will."
